Varied Portfolio of Prudential Pension Plans

The array of pension offerings from Prudential encompasses personal pensions for the independent planner, workplace pensions that benefit from employer contributions, and annuities ensuring a lifetime income. Each product is crafted to address unique retirement trajectories and financial objectives.

Nearing Retirement: Utilization Options

Approaching retirement unlocks several avenues for using your pension. Whether it’s withdrawing a tax-free portion, converting to an annuity, or opting for flexible drawdowns, Prudential offers avenues tailored to your withdrawal preferences.

The Pros and Cons of Pension Transfers

Consolidating your retirement funds with Prudential might present improved management prospects; however, weighing fees and benefit trade-offs are essential before committing to a transfer.
